Architectural Character and Heritage Charm
The warmest spots often show Sydney’s history. They might have exposed sandstone or old wooden beams. These older buildings offer warmth that new places simply cannot match.
The Power of Palettes and Textures
A room’s colours and materials are very important. Warmth comes from rich fabrics like velvet and dark leather. Choose deep colours and warm, earthy shades over plain white walls.
Lighting: The Secret Ingredient to Intimacy
Cold, bright white lights kill the warm feeling immediately. Great private dining rooms use soft lamps and dim chandeliers. This warm, yellow light makes the room feel soft and very inviting.

Capacity vs. Intimacy: Sizing the Space Right
A room that is too big will instantly feel cold and empty. Choose a room that feels comfortable for your group's size. This proportionality maintains the intimate atmosphere you are seeking.
Menu Customisation and Personal Touch
The service must be flexible to feel truly welcoming. Can the chef make a special menu for your guests? Being able to change the meal shows the venue cares about your experience a lot.
Dedicated Service: Unobtrusive and Attentive
The staff makes a room feel warm and friendly. Look for venues with dedicated, quiet servers just for your room. Great service should feel smooth and never rushed or hurried.

Tips for a Welcoming Atmosphere
- Play soft background music during your dinner.
- The volume should allow easy conversation at the table.
- Ask if you can use your own personal playlist for the event.
- Use low flowers that do not block people's views.
- Use textured or coloured tablecloths for added warmth.
- Small candles or place cards add a lot of charm to the setting.
- The room should block the loud city noise outside.
- A nice, quiet view is often the best for guests.
- Closing the door creates a great feeling of seclusion and peace.
